Pipe Snaking in Denver, CO
Pipe snaking services are designed to clear blockages and restore proper flow in residential plumbing systems. This process involves inserting a specialized auger or plumbing snake into clogged drains, such as kitchen sinks, bathroom drains, or main sewer lines, to break up or dislodge debris like hair, grease, soap buildup, or small objects. Property owners often request pipe snaking when they notice slow draining fixtures, foul odors, or recurring backups, aiming to quickly resolve common clogs without extensive excavation or replacement.
Before requesting pipe snaking, homeowners should consider the location and nature of the blockage, as well as any ongoing drain issues. It’s helpful to identify which fixtures are affected and whether multiple drains are impacted simultaneously, as this can indicate a larger problem within the main sewer line. Understanding the history of drain problems and any previous repairs can also assist in determining if pipe snaking is an appropriate solution, or if further inspection might be necessary to prevent future issues.

Pipe Snaking Questions
What is pipe snaking? Pipe snaking involves using a specialized auger tool to clear clogs and obstructions in drain and sewer lines.
When is pipe snaking recommended? It is suitable for removing blockages caused by debris, grease buildup, or tree roots in household or commercial pipes.
How does pipe snaking work? The process uses a flexible auger that is inserted into the pipe to break up or retrieve obstructions, restoring proper flow.
What types of pipes can be snaked? Pipe snaking can be performed on various pipes, including main sewer lines, kitchen drains, bathroom pipes, and outdoor sewer connections.
